  • Photoshop Elements 8. "Could not use Clone Stamp Tool because of a program error."  Please help.

    Photoshop Elements 8.  "Could not use Clone Stamp Tool because of a program error."  Please help.

    Try this:
    Open your picture file
    Access the clone stamp tool
    Hold down the ALT key on the keyboard and left click on the area from which you wish to clone, then release the ALT key, and click to place the pixels at the destination
    TIPS:
    It is a good idea to open a blank layer at the top in the layers palette, and do the cloning on this layer. Be sure that "sample all layers" at the top is checked. You can change the layer opacity if necessary
    Use the bracket keys next to the letter p on the keyboard to increase & decrease the size of the cursor

  • My Photoshop CS 5 has some strange actions when I copy a portion of a photo using the clone stamp  to transfer to another part of the image. It carries the entire layer (not just the stamps selection) across the screen and I cannot place it where I need t

    My Photoshop CS 5 has some strange actions when I copy a portion of a photo using the clone stamp  to transfer to another part of the image. It carries the entire layer (not just the stamps selection) across the screen and I cannot place it where I need to. It appears as if I selected the entire layer on purpose (which I did not)
    The below items appeared when I opened Photoshop CS 5:
    “Photoshop has encountered a problem with the display driver and has temporarily disabled G & U enhancements. Check the video card malfunctions website for latest software. GPU enhancements can be enabled in the performance panel of preferences.”
    (I believe this started after the automatically updated Windows was applied. It was coincident with the before mentioned problem . . . but I don’t really know if it had anything to do with it. )

    For the Clone Stamp problem, check the Clone Source panel and Clipped is probably unchecked.
    If so, check Clipped and see if that makes a difference.
    (Window>Clone Source)

    Have you applied the Photoshop 11.0.1 Patch?
    Have you updated the video drivers?
    If that doesn't help, try resetting your preferences as described in the FAQ.
    http://forums.adobe.com/thread/375776?tstart=0
    You either have to physically delete (or rename) the preference files or, if using the Alt, Ctrl, and Shift method, be sure that you get a confirmation dialog.
    This resets all settings in Photoshop to factory defaults.
    (A complete uninstall/re-install will not affect the preferences and a corrupt file there may be causing the problem.)

  • Why is the clone stamp no longer transparent?

    When I try to clone in versions beyond PS3 the clone stamp is not transparent. I can't see what's underneath, it got fuzzy pixels.
    How can I set this to behave the way it used to.
    Thanks.
    MK

    In the Window>Clone Source panel you can adjust how the overlay is shown.
    For example, i usually have it set to show the overlay, clipped and opacity at 50%.
    It's really a matter of preference though, so you might try some of the different settings and see which one(s) work for you
    or you can simply turn the overlay off if that suits you.
